**Job Title:** Identity Access Manager
**Role Summary:**
Lead and manage the enterprise Identity and Access Management (IAM) program, overseeing the implementation, operation, and continuous improvement of Identity Governance and Administration (IGA) tools. Ensure IAM processes align with security frameworks, regulatory requirements, and business objectives while driving automation, security, and user experience across on‑premises and cloud environments.
**Expectations:**
- 10+ years of experience in cybersecurity with a focus on IAM/IGA.
- Proven ability to lead cross‑functional teams and mentor junior staff.
- Strong knowledge of regulatory mandates (e.g., SOX, HIPAA, GDPR, CCPA, PCI DSS, FDA) and security frameworks (NIST, ISO, CIS, COBIT).
- Demonstrated expertise in designing scalable IAM architectures and driving adoption of best‑practice policies.
**Key Responsibilities:**
- Direct enterprise‑wide IAM operations and manage day‑to‑day IAM program activities.
- Deploy, integrate, and maintain the IGA tool, ensuring compliance and seamless operation.
- Define, enforce, and continuously improve IAM policies, standards, and procedures.
- Conduct regular audits and risk assessments in collaboration with GRC teams.
- Design, build, and sustain Directory Services across on‑prem, Azure, and AWS platforms.
- Architect secure authentication/authorization patterns and reference architectures.
- Lead gap assessments, remediation planning, and roadmap execution for IAM initiatives.
- Provide training and communication to cross‑functional teams on IAM practices.
- Stay current on IAM trends; recommend and implement automation and process enhancements.
**Required Skills:**
- Deep technical expertise with Microsoft Entra ID, Azure AD, ADFS, SSO, MFA, SAML, and PAM solutions.
- Experience configuring, testing, and evaluating IAM/IGA security tools.
- Strong analytical, problem‑solving, and technical documentation abilities.
- Excellent written and verbal communication; ability to translate technical concepts for business audiences.
- Strong interpersonal, facilitation, and influencing skills; capable of leading without direct authority.
- Professional planning, organizational, and presentation competencies.
**Required Education & Certifications:**
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Security, or related field (or equivalent experience).
- Certified Information Systems Security Professional (CISSP) required.
- Additional IAM‑related certifications (e.g., Certified Identity and Access Manager, Azure Security Engineer) are a plus.
